This means that only those who can unlock or access the database who have the password of that DB file have the right to edit the data within it.<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Launch Microsoft Access\u00a0<strong>&gt;&gt;<\/strong> choose\u00a0<strong>Open<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Choose the\u00a0<strong>Browse <\/strong>option &gt;&gt; select the .<strong>ACCDB file<\/strong>\u00a0to set the password.<\/li>\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Now, from the dropdown, you have to choose the\u00a0\u201c<strong>Open Exclusive\u201d <\/strong>option &gt;&gt; hit a\u00a0<strong>File\u00a0<\/strong>tab.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-68069 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/07\/open-access-2010-database-exclusive-6.png\" alt=\"Open Exclusive\" width=\"600\" height=\"361\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Then, click on\u00a0<strong>Info <\/strong>option &gt;&gt; choose <strong>Encrypt with Password<\/strong>\u00a0option to lock the Access database.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-68059 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/08\/pdf_encrytion_2.png\" alt=\"Encrypt with Password\" width=\"349\" height=\"305\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Finally, enter the <strong>database password <\/strong>&amp; verify it.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<blockquote>\n<p style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Also Read: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/access-ldb-or-laccdb-file-unlock\">Unlock Or Remove Access Database LDB\/LACCDB File<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<p><a name=\"s2\"><\/a><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Way 2- Setting Up the User-Level Security in Access<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">User-level security is another effective resolution to lock the Access database from editing. You can eventually create diverse user groups &amp; assign specific permissions to allow only selected entities can make edits.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Here are the steps to apply this method: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li>Open your MS Access database.<\/li>\n<li>Go to the &#8220;<strong>Tools<\/strong>&#8221; menu &gt;&gt; click on the &#8220;<strong>Security<\/strong>&#8221; &gt;&gt; &#8220;<strong>User and Group Accounts<\/strong>.&#8221;<\/li>\n<li>Now, create user accounts with limited permissions for editing.<\/li>\n<li>Give permission to each user &amp; save the changes.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><a name=\"s3\"><\/a><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Way 3- How to Lock Access Database from Editing by Making the DB Read-Only<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Many users have reported that they protected their databases by making them read-only. Although this tactic is ideal if you want users to view the data without making changes.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><strong>Steps to Make a Database Read-Only:<\/strong><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Launch Windows File Explorer.<\/li>\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Find your Access DB file and right-click on it to select the &#8220;<strong>Properties<\/strong>.&#8221;<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-68296 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2017\/08\/select-properties.png\" alt=\"Properties\" width=\"343\" height=\"515\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">In the &#8220;<strong>General<\/strong>&#8221; tab, you have to check &#8220;Read-only&#8221; box.<\/li>\n<li style=\"text-align: left;\">Choose &#8220;<strong>Apply<\/strong>&#8221; &gt;&gt; &#8220;<strong>OK<\/strong>&#8221; to save the changes.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><a name=\"s4\"><\/a><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Way 4- Splitting the Database<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/split-access-database-front-end-back-end-databases\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><strong>Splitting the MS Access database<\/strong><\/a> into a front-end &amp; back-end file can offer better control. The back end holds the data tables, while the front end holds forms, reports, and queries. However, by locking the back end and granting limited permissions to the front end, you can efficiently prevent editing.<\/p>\n<p><a name=\"s5\"><\/a><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Way 5- How to Password Protect Access Database by Disabling Design Changes?<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">There is another yet option to protect Access database from editing is disabling design changes in your database. This certifies that users can only access the DB in a predefined structure.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Follow the below instructions carefully to disable design changes:<\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li>Open your database.<\/li>\n<li>Navigate to &#8220;<strong>File<\/strong>&#8221; tab &gt;&gt; click &#8220;<strong>Options<\/strong>&#8221; &gt;&gt; &#8220;<strong>Current Database<\/strong><strong>.<\/strong>&#8220;<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-68887 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/www.accessrepairnrecovery.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/10\/image-9.png\" alt=\"Current Database\" width=\"640\" height=\"216\" \/><\/p>\n<ul style=\"text-align: justify;\">\n<li>After that, scroll to a &#8220;Design&#8221; section &amp; disable the option &#8220;<strong>Allow Design Changes<\/strong>&#8220;.<\/li>\n<li>Press CTRL+ S to save the changes you have made.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Related FAQs:<\/strong><\/h2>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Can You Lock an Access Database from Editing?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Yes, the Microsoft Access database can be easily locked from editing by applying the solutions outlined in this blog.<\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>What Is One Method to Secure MS Access Database to Prevent Accidental Damage?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Creating a backup of the Access database or setting up user-level security can help you to secure the MS Access database to prevent accidental damage.<\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>How to Protect the Database Against Threats or Unauthorized Access?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">You can use strong encryption to protect the database against threats or unauthorized access.<\/p>\n<h4 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>What Are the Two Types of Database Lock?<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The two types of database locks in Microsoft Access are shared locks and exclusive locks.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: left;\"><strong>Bottom Line<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">So here it comes to the end of this blog.
